前言
在 Java Web 开发中,Tomcat 是最常用的轻量级容器。很多初学者在项目启动失败时,往往忽略了基础环境的配置。本文将手把手带你完成从下载、安装到集成主流 IDE 的全过程,确保你的开发环境稳定可靠。
下载与安装
访问 Apache Tomcat 官网获取安装包。建议选择 .zip 压缩包版本,解压即可使用,无需复杂安装程序。
注意: 解压路径尽量保持纯英文,避免中文路径导致后续报错。
目录结构解析
解压后你会看到几个关键文件夹,理解它们有助于排查问题:
bin:存放启动脚本(如startup.bat)和关闭脚本。conf:核心配置文件,包括端口设置、用户权限等。lib:存放 Tomcat 运行所需的依赖库。logs:运行时日志文件,出错时优先查看此处。webapps:默认部署项目的目录。work:JSP 编译后的临时文件缓存。
启动与验证
在此之前,得先确认 JDK 装好了。如果缺少环境变量,启动时会提示 JAVA_HOME 未定义的错误。
Windows 系统下,进入 bin 目录双击 startup.bat 即可启动。Linux 或 macOS 则使用 startup.sh。
启动成功后,浏览器访问 http://localhost:8080。若看到 Tomcat 欢迎页,说明服务正常。
注意: 默认端口为 8080。若被占用,需修改 conf/server.xml 中的 Connector 端口号。
你也可以通过命令行直接启动:
cd apache-tomcat-9.0.43/bin
startup
出现控制台窗口即表示服务已拉起。
配置环境变量
为了方便全局调用,建议配置系统环境变量。
- 右键'此电脑' -> '属性' -> '高级系统设置' -> '环境变量'。
- 新建系统变量
CATALINA_HOME,值为 Tomcat 的安装根目录。 - 编辑
Path变量,追加%CATALINA_HOME%\bin。 弄完这些,重启一下终端即可在任何位置使用 Tomcat 命令。
集成 IntelliJ IDEA
在 IDEA 中配置 Tomcat 能让调试更便捷。
- 打开
Settings->Build, Execution, Deployment->Application Servers。 - 点击
+号选择Tomcat Server->Local。 - 指定 Tomcat 的安装目录,保存即可。
- 在顶部工具栏点击
Edit Configurations,添加新的Tomcat Server配置,关联刚才设置的服务器。
部分旧版本 IDEA 可能在菜单路径上略有不同,但核心逻辑一致:找到服务器配置入口,指向本地 Tomcat 路径。
集成 Eclipse
Eclipse 的配置流程类似:
- 进入
Window->Preferences->Server->Runtime Environments。

